JinkoSolar Holding Subsidiary Announces RMB 315 Million Investment in Xinte High Purity Polysilicon Production Project in Inner Mongolia with Annual Capacity of 100,000 Tons

SHANGRAO, China, June 21, 2021 /PRNewswire/ — JinkoSolar Holding Co., Ltd. (the “Company” or “JinkoSolar”) (NYSE: JKS), one of the world’s largest and most innovative solar module manufacturers, today announced its holding subsidiary, Shangrao JinkoSolar Industry Development Co., ltd. plans to invest 315 million RMB of monetary capital to increase the capital and shares of Inner Mongolia Xinte Silicon Materials Co., Ltd. (“Inner Mongolia Xinte”), a wholly owned subsidiary of Xinte Energy Co., Ltd. (“Xinte Energy”) (HKEX: 1799). The investment will be used for the construction of a high-purity polysilicon production line with an annual capacity of 100,000 tons. After completion of the capital increase, the Company will hold a 9.00% stake in Inner Mongolia Xinte.

About JinkoSolar Holding Co., Ltd.
JinkoSolar (NYSE: JKS) is one of the largest and most innovative solar module manufacturers in the world. JinkoSolar distributes its solar products and sells its solutions and services to a diverse international utility, commercial and residential customer base in China, United States, Japan, Germanythe UK, Chile, South Africa, India, Mexico, Brazilthe United Arab Emirates, Italy, Spain, France, Belgium, and other countries and regions. JinkoSolar has built a vertically integrated solar product value chain, with an annual integrated capacity of 22 GW for monowafers, 11 GW for solar cells and 31 GW for solar modules, from December 31, 2020.
